Rolling 12 Month SUM

Thanks to all who reply,

 

I have a table showing material #, Revenue, Qty. I created a card to display the Rolling 12 mth Revenue total.

 

Net Sales rolling 12 mth =
CALCULATE(
SUM ( salesMaster[netRevenue] ),
DATESBETWEEN (
'Date Table'[Date],
NEXTDAY(SAMEPERIODLASTYEAR ( LASTDATE ('Date Table'[Date] ) ) ), LASTDATE('Date Table'[Date] )))

 

Date Table for years 2017- 2022.

BLD65_1-1651864589721.png

 

The problem is that I am only seeing the revenue total for this year (2022). I need to include the previous 8 months from 2021.

 

I want the Card to show the previous 12 months up to the current month. ( May 2021 - April 2022 ).

Net Sales rolling 12 mth =
CALCULATE(
    SUM( salesMaster[netRevenue] ),
    DATESINPERIOD( 'Date Table'[Date], MAX( 'Date Table'[Date] ), -12, MONTH )
)
